I'm not sure if this is a federal or state thing but here in Texas, it's my understanding that patients are legally entitled to copies of all their records, test results, bloodwork results,etc. I've never had a problem getting mine. Now, I know that some drs. offices will charge you to make copies but I've never had to pay any of mine. Also, they definitely charge if the requests come from insurance cos.,etc. where they might have to copy your whole file which can sometimes be VERY long- my file records at my PCP's office look like "War and Peace".....So, it may be that different states have different laws- maybe someone else will know more about what's what in different places than I do.
